Find Your Perfect Feline Match

Different cat breeds have distinct personalities and needs. Choosing a cat that fits your lifestyle is crucial for a harmonious relationship.

Active Breeds

Ideal for owners with plenty of time for interaction and play. Examples: Siamese, Bengal.

Quiet Breeds

Perfect for those who prefer calm and gentle companionship. Examples: Persian, British Shorthair.

Independent Breeds

Suitable for busy owners who can't provide constant attention. Examples: Russian Blue, Norwegian Forest Cat.

Cuddly Breeds

Great for owners who enjoy and can give lots of attention. Examples: Ragdoll, Exotic Shorthair.

How to Choose the Right Cat Food

Selecting the right cat food is crucial for your cat's health. Here are some factors to consider when choosing cat food:

Choose by Age

Kittens, adults, and seniors have different nutritional needs; select age-appropriate food.

Consider Health Conditions

Cats with specific health issues (like kidney disease, allergies) may require prescription diets.

Check Ingredient Lists

High-quality protein should be the first ingredient; avoid excessive additives and fillers.

Mind Weight Management

Choose food with appropriate calories based on your cat's activity level and weight to prevent obesity.

Cat Food Type Comparison

Dry Food

  • Convenient storage and feeding
  • Helps maintain dental health
  • Lower moisture content

Wet Food

  • High moisture content, aids hydration
  • Typically higher in protein
  • Needs refrigeration after opening

Mixed Feeding

  • Combines benefits of dry and wet food
  • Increases dietary variety
  • Requires more planning and management
